EducationRe: Help! Lecturer Wants To Ruin My Life by kokoye(m): 6:36pm On Feb 27, 2012
Sorry, but you cant take stuff like this lightly . .and you really dont want your husband to handle it.

My cousin's been in this kinda situatio nbefore and I will tell you how it was handled. LASU as well

She saved all his text messages and also got some phone call recordings as proof.

Then some wealthy and high society female family members went to her dept, asked for the HOD and lecturer, made sure they were available, then made a HUGE NOISE with all the accusations and proof. Threats of torture and jail time involved. Of course, they made sure a huge crowd gathered and played back the video recordings and text messages.

No one EVER tried messing with my cousin until she graduated.

BusinessRe: Why Do Nigerian Small Businesses Fail From Inception? by kokoye(m): 4:03pm On Feb 24, 2012
- If you go into a business with the sole purpose of making money in a short term (others are doing it so you think it will work for you too), it will fail in most cases.

- If you go into a business without adequate planning, it will fail in most cases.  #project_management

- If you go into a business without enough startup capital (enough money to sustain the growth), it will fail in most cases.

- If you go into a business in an environment with no maintenance culture, it wont last in most cases

- The Nigerian environment also does not help matters - you have to generate your own electricity, water, security, etc

- If you go into a business where the banks are not willing to give you loans, it is even harder.

- If you go into a business where the little income you make is used for family events, it will fail in most cases.

- If you go into a business in a country where you friends and family believe they dont have to pay for your services, it will fail in most cases

- If you go into a business where the closest business partner, friend or family is always trying 'obtain' you, it will be tough.

- If you to into a business in a country where people call everything locally made 'fake' and only run after oyinbo goods, it is even tougher.
